Yes, Both the stone and the setting came from Whiteflash. From searching for the stone and designing the setting and to when I received the ring it probably took about a month and a half to 2 months. It only took so long because I had a hard time deciding on the stone and the setting. Whiteflash has been great with working with me. I am lucky enough to live in Houston so I went to Whiteflash a few times to look at several different stones. I actually have been shopping around for a stone since January this year. I passed on a few good stones at other places only to realize that prices were going up. So when I saw one that I actually liked I jumped on it. I bought the stone and had them hold on to it for over 2 weeks while I went around town trying to figure out what kind of setting I wanted.


Once I picked the stone I wanted. I started to look at different settings. I had a setting that I already knew my girlfriend really liked picked out in my mind. However, I did not know that Whiteflash would not exactly copy a designer setting. So, that set me back. I went to every store in the mall and went on various websites to get an idea of what different settings looked like. I am a very visual person so I had to see how things look like in person before I could make a decision. It is always hard to look at a picture and feel comfortable with the way it looks. I went to Tiffany’s, De Beers, Cartier, each more than 2 times to get a good idea of the different styles. Deciding on what I wanted was the hardest part.


Once I picked out several rings I liked I decided to put all the features that I liked from those Designer rings together. I provided a drawing that I made as well as pictures of the other rings of the different characteristics of each ring that I liked and sent them in to Whiteflash. Communication was very important because the first CAD that they provided was totally wrong. I got very disappointed with the outcome. Tracy at Whiteflash stepped in and had Brian give me a call and we met up to discuss the ring. Once we came into agreement on the design they ordered another CAD. During this time a few people went on vacation so that set things back a few days. But once I had approved the CAD I posted it on Pricescope to get people''s opinions. I think that was July 24th.


A few days later I got an email from the production team that said the Cast had failed on the first attempt to make the ring and that they were going to try again and that it would set things back a week. So I did have a few hiccups throughout the process. The CAD drawing does not do the ring anY justice. The pictures they sent me turned out ok, but it was not until I received the ring that I was truly impressed. All in all I am very pleased with my ring and my total experience with Whiteflash. Everyone''s hard work really paid off. Kudos to everyone at Whiteflash. Tracy was great to work with. She and I have spoken over the phone and emailed each other so often, we have become friends. I am sure Brian is tired of me too. I saw him a more than a few times.

I am not going to pop the question anytime soon, but when I do give her the ring I hope she appreciates the hard work I had to go through to make this all happen!
I hope that this answers any questions that you had. If you have more please feel free to ask!
